But as we all know fashion trends such as celebrity tattoos, do not pop and stop at the edge of the Red Carpet. It seems US teen pregnancies are on the rise after a steady decline from 1991 to 2005. According to the National Center for Health Statistics, birth rates for teenagers aged 15 to 17 rose by 3 percent in 2006, the first increase since 1991. In fact, recent news headlines covered a teenage "pregnancy pact" in the Northeast has US authorities investigating 17 schoolgirls intentionally expecting babies they plan to raise together as a group. Some sources are pointing fingers and the blame on Hollywood celebrities for glamorizing pregnancy with recent films such as Juno and Knocked Up, not to mention TV teen network Nickelodeon’s star Jamie Lynn Spears, and sister of pop idol Britney Spears, herself another young mother, giving birth this week at age 17.
